Why does opening Outlook Contacts make Outlook crash?

Thread view: 
Enable EMail Alerts  Start New Thread
Thread rating: 
IT Support - 19 May 2006 17:44 GMT
We have an Outlook 2000 user whose Outlook crashes soon after entering her
contacts.  Any suggestions or answers as to why this might be happening?  
Other functions in Outlook are fine.  She is running Windows 2000.
TIA
Michae Lim
Vince Averello [MVP-Outlook] - 19 May 2006 19:01 GMT
It's a catch-all but you might want to try running ScanPST.EXE on her PST
file, if she has one.

Also, do you have any more details about the error?
